Transaction ecc3fe9f918ae6295efeb32cfebc6af30270e846aedd22260fc0a8bb81de0cd7
1 Input
1 Output
-
ecc3fe9f918ae6295efeb32cfebc6af30270e846aedd22260fc0a8bb81de0cd7:0
- value
- 597462
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c31a08c86c708028ecff0a98b0059e5d8e7a55a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JnbxJYCo2DPa9C1y829C1KeDCBfuM3W78